Join NACG as a Journeyperson Mechanic specializing in heavy equipment at our remote mining sites in Fort McMurray. Ensure safe operations while working on CAT, Hitachi, and Komatsu models.

This role is tailored for skilled mechanics with a focus on diagnostics and preventative maintenance. Work a 14x14 rotation, where you'll be instrumental in troubleshooting and repairing critical equipment. Embrace a culture of safety while contributing to efficient operations at the Suncor site.

Key Responsibilities:
• Diagnose and repair off-road equipment malfunctions
• Perform regular equipment maintenance
• Develop work scopes for repair operations
• Mentor and guide apprentices in mechanical skills
• Maintain accurate records and reports

Requirements:
• Journeyperson certification in Heavy Equipment
• Minimum 2 years post-certification experience
• Strong skills in diagnostics and troubleshooting
• Leadership abilities in a cooperative team
• Valid driver's license and up-to-date training certificates

Contribute your mechanical expertise in a challenging environment with NACG, enhancing heavy equipment reliability in Fort McMurray.
